What Causes Sudden Changes in Female Body Scent?

Biologically, the primary driver for these shifts is the endocrine system. When estrogen levels decline, particularly during perimenopause, the brain receives false signals that the body is overheating constantly.

This triggers the “fight or flight” response, activating the apocrine glands. Unlike eccrine glands which produce watery sweat, apocrine glands release a thicker fluid rich in proteins and lipids.

Bacteria on the skin thrive on these substances. As microorganisms break down these specific molecules, they release pungent byproducts, which explains why some women experience increased body odor during hormonal transitions.

How Does Menopause Affect Sweat Gland Activity?

The hypothalamus acts as the body’s thermostat. During the menopausal transition, lower estrogen concentrations make this internal regulator much more sensitive to slight changes in core body temperature.

Consequently, the body initiates cooling mechanisms like hot flashes and night sweats more frequently. Frequent perspiration provides a constant breeding ground for odor-causing bacteria to multiply across the dermis.

Furthermore, the chemical composition of sweat changes with age. Research suggests that certain compounds, such as 2-nonenal, may increase, contributing to a different scent profile that many women find unfamiliar.

Why Do Stress and Anxiety Intensify Body Odor?

Emotional stress triggers a different physiological reaction than physical heat. Stress-induced sweat comes almost exclusively from the apocrine glands located in the armpits and groin areas, rather than the forehead.

Because this sweat is more nutrient-dense, it produces a stronger aroma almost immediately upon contact with skin flora. High cortisol levels further disrupt the delicate balance of the skin’s protective acid mantle.

When the skin’s pH shifts, less-desirable bacteria can dominate the microbiome. This shift is a major reason why some women experience increased body odor during high-pressure career or family phases.

Comparative Analysis of Sweat Gland Types

FeatureEccrine GlandsApocrine Glands
Primary LocationAll over the bodyArmpits, groin, scalp
TriggerHeat and exerciseStress and hormones
Sweat CompositionWater and saltProteins and fatty acids
Odor PotentialVery lowVery high (bacterial action)
Activity LevelConstantIncreases during puberty/menopause

Which Dietary Factors Influence Skin Chemistry?

What you consume significantly impacts how your pores “breathe.” Cruciferous vegetables, while incredibly healthy, contain sulfur compounds that the body often excretes through sweat, potentially sharpening your natural scent.

Spicy foods containing capsaicin can also trick the brain into thinking the body is hot. This leads to excessive sweating, providing more moisture for bacteria to process into malodorous compounds.

According to The North American Menopause Society (NAMS), tracking triggers like caffeine and alcohol can help women identify specific lifestyle habits that correlate with increased perspiration and odor.

Standard soaps often fail to address the specific bacterial shifts associated with hormonal changes. Using pH-balanced cleansers helps maintain the skin’s natural defense barrier against the overgrowth of odor-producing microbes.

Natural fibers like cotton, linen, and silk allow the skin to breathe and moisture to evaporate. Synthetic fabrics trap sweat against the skin, creating a warm, anaerobic environment for bacteria.

Many dermatologists now recommend clinical-strength antiperspirants applied at night. This allows the aluminum salts to effectively plug sweat ducts while the body is at its coolest and driest state.

When Should You Consult a Medical Professional?

While most scent changes are benign, sudden or “fruity” odors can sometimes indicate metabolic issues. If hygiene changes do not help, it is vital to rule out conditions like diabetes.

Thyroid imbalances can also cause excessive sweating and changes in skin chemistry. A simple blood test can determine if your symptoms are purely hormonal or related to a broader systemic issue.

Persistent changes that affect your quality of life deserve clinical attention. Doctors can provide hormone replacement therapy (HRT) or prescription-grade topicals to help mitigate the underlying causes if the symptoms become overwhelming.

Frequently Asked Questions

Does menopause cause a permanent change in body odor?

Not necessarily. While the scent profile may change during the transition, many women find that their body chemistry stabilizes once they reach postmenopause and hormone levels level out.

Can supplements help reduce hormonal sweat?

Some women find relief with Black Cohosh or Vitamin E, but results vary. Always consult with a healthcare provider before starting new supplements to ensure they do not interfere with other medications.

Why does my sweat smell like ammonia?

An ammonia scent often occurs when the body breaks down protein for energy instead of carbohydrates. This can happen during intense exercise or if you are on a high-protein, low-carb diet.

Is “old person smell” a real thing for women?

There is a specific compound called 2-nonenal that increases as we age. However, diligent skin care and hydration can significantly minimize its presence and keep your scent fresh.

Does HRT help with body odor?

Yes, Hormone Replacement Therapy can stabilize the hypothalamus, reducing the frequency of hot flashes and night sweats, which directly decreases the amount of sweat available for bacteria to process.
